2010-01-13 2 views
0

1) 마스터리스트에서 아이콘을 터치하고 드래그하여 목록을 만들고 싶습니다. 2) 새로 생성 된 목록에서 항목을 삭제하거나 순서를 재정렬 할 수도 있습니다.iPhone 터치 & 드래그 인터페이스를 사용하여 직관적 인리스트 생성

이 기능을 완벽하게 수행하기 위해 디자인 포인터를 보거나 가능한 코드 샘플이 있습니까?

내가 실현 UITableView이 실현할 수 있습니다. 그러나 한 화면에서 시각적으로 처리하는 것은 직면 한 작업의 전반적인 컨텍스트를 유지하면서 직관적입니다.

감사 API의 UI 클래스의

답변

1

없음이 작업을 수행 할 수 없습니다. 테이블 뷰와 스크롤 뷰 모두 전체 화면을 원합니다. 당신은 처음부터 많은 것을 써야 할 것입니다.

이중 목록 디자인이 좋지 않은 인터페이스 선택이라는 것을 알게 될 것입니다. 동일한보기 내에서 두 개의 목록을 표시하고 조작하기 위해 iPhone 화면에 실제로 공간이 없습니다. 화면에서 벗어난 경우 두 목록 모두를 볼 수는 없습니다.

"직관적 인"마케팅은 "익숙한"마케팅입니다. 비표준 인터페이스에 대해 직관적 인 것은 없습니다. iPhone 사용자는 목록 사이에서 항목을 일상적으로 끌지 않으므로 인터페이스를 작동하는 방법을 쉽게 알 수 없습니다. 사용자가 개별 셀을 검사하여 하위 목록에 추가 할 수있는 단일 마스터 테이블을 사용하는 것이 가장 좋습니다. 이것은 iPhone의 일반적인 인터페이스이므로보다 직관적입니다.

이 작업에 많은 시간을 보내기 전에 장치 자체에 표시되는 모형을 만드는 것이 좋습니다. 그래픽 프로그램에서 모의 ​​인터페이스를 그리기 만하면 이미지 뷰에 이미지로 표시 할 수 있습니다. 이렇게하면 유용 할 이중 목록에 충분한 정보를 표시 할 수 있는지 여부와 두 목록의 요소를 안정적으로 조회 할 수 있는지 여부를 테스트 할 수 있습니다.

+0

감사합니다. TechZen. 뒤늦은 시야에서 나는 당신에게 동의합니다. – Roby